Hemant Vishwakarma THESEOBACKLINK.COM seohelpdesk96@gmail.com
Welcome to THESEOBACKLINK.COM
Email Us - seohelpdesk96@gmail.com
directory-link.com | smartseoarticle.com | webdirectorylink.com | directory-web.com | smartseobacklink.com | seobackdirectory.com | smart-article.com

Article -> Article Details

Title Database Homework Help: Step-by-Step Tutorial
Category Education --> Universities
Meta Keywords database homework help, homework help website
Owner Imran
Description

Are you struggling with database homework help? This “Database Homework Help: Step‑by‑Step Tutorial” is your ticket out of confusion—and into clarity. Picture turning complex SQL queries and normalization headaches into manageable, even enjoyable tasks. In this guide, we’ll walk you methodically through each stage—understanding schemas, crafting ER diagrams, writing clean SQL, and optimizing performance—so you’ll not only finish your assignment but truly grasp the logic behind it.


Curious about how to transform a tangled set of requirements into a polished database schema? Want to see how mastering one concept propels the next seamlessly? You’re about to discover practical techniques and insider tips that turn homework into skill-building. Ready to demystify your database challenges and build real confidence? Let’s dive in.

1. Understand Database Fundamentals

Start with the basics. A database stores, manages, and retrieves data efficiently. Learn key concepts like tables, records, fields, and primary keys. Understand how relational databases differ from NoSQL. Learn what DBMS (Database Management System) tools do. Terms like schema, constraints, and queries should become familiar.

2. Install & Get Hands-On

Now, install a database management system. MySQL, PostgreSQL, or SQLite are great to begin with. Follow setup guides from the official websites. Use command-line tools and graphical interfaces like MySQL Workbench. Hands-on practice boosts your learning speed by 70% over reading alone.

3. Design Database Schema

A schema is your database’s structure. Start by defining tables, columns, and relationships. For example, an e-commerce schema includes tables like Users, Orders, and Products. Use ER diagrams (Entity-Relationship diagrams) to visualize relationships. Designing well early saves time during queries.

4. Normalize Your Schema

Normalization reduces redundancy and improves efficiency. Learn the first three normal forms (1NF, 2NF, 3NF). For example, move repeating groups into separate tables (1NF). Remove partial dependencies (2NF) and transitive dependencies (3NF). A normalized database is easier to update and scale.

5. Write SQL Queries

Practice writing SQL queries to fetch, insert, update, or delete data. Start with basic SELECT statements, then try JOIN, GROUP BY, and subqueries. Use WHERE clauses for filtering. SQL is all about logic—focus on structure and order.


Need extra support with SQL commands or schema errors? Reach out to expert database homework help or join online forums before you get overwhelmed with your database homework.

6. Explore Transactions & ACID

Transactions group queries to run as a single unit. They ensure data consistency. Learn the ACID properties: Atomicity, Consistency, Isolation, and Durability. For instance, bank transfers must either complete fully or not at all—thanks to transactions.

7. Advance to Indexing & Query Optimization

Indexes speed up data retrieval. Learn how to create indexes on frequently searched fields. Use EXPLAIN to analyze slow queries. Optimizing a query can reduce load time by over 60%. Efficient queries mean faster results and lower server usage.

8. Practice with Real Assignments

Theory alone isn't enough. Work on actual database problems. Use online platforms or your course assignments. Build databases for school systems, blogs, or stores. One real-world project equals hours of textbook reading.

9. Use Quality Learning Resources

Choose reliable resources to learn smarter. Sites like W3Schools, GeeksforGeeks, and SQLZoo offer structured tutorials. YouTube channels with walkthroughs help visual learners. Use textbooks like Database System Concepts by Silberschatz for deeper understanding.

10. Validate & Debug

Always validate your data and schema. Check if data types match, constraints work, and relationships hold. Debug SQL errors by reading error messages closely. Simple typos or logic mistakes cause most issues. A structured approach helps you catch more bugs.

11. Troubleshooting & Community Help

Facing an issue? Check Stack Overflow, Reddit, or GitHub discussions. Use keywords like “MySQL foreign key error” or “PostgreSQL slow query” to search. Communities offer fast, practical help. Also, don't hesitate to ask peers or instructors.

Conclusion

Ready to turn theory into mastery? This step-by-step tutorial equips you with essential tools to conquer database assignments confidently. But don’t stop here—put what you’ve learned into practice, tackle real-world problems, and seek feedback. The more you engage, the faster your skills grow. Are you curious to see how far you can go with structured learning and hands-on experience? Dive deeper, explore new challenges, and let your database expertise speak for itself. The journey has just begun!